If you love jazz and you’ve never been to a MOJO meeting, you’ve really missed something. MOJO stands for the Mystic Order of the Jazz Obsessed. The group meets on the 4th Monday of each month, and you don’t have to be a member to attend. Each meeting features a live performance and a light jambalaya dinner for $10. Yes, $10! the Crescent Theater on Dauphin Street downtown. Last week the powers that be in Hollywood announced the 2010 Oscar nominations. Five of the ten nominees for Best Picture played here in Mobile at, of all places, The Crescent (An Education, The Hurt Locker, Inglourious Basterds, A Serious Man, and Up in the Air).
